{"id":"d8c9604b-8a36-4478-86fa-ac03db334bb3","slug":"waymo-flood-water-recall-2026-04","kind":"recall","headline":"Waymo recalls 3,791 driverless taxis over risk of driving into flooded roadways","summary":"On April 20, 2026, an unoccupied Waymo autonomous vehicle encountered an untraversable flooded section of roadway with a 40 mph speed limit; it detected the water but proceeded at reduced speed rather than stopping. Waymo's Safety Board reviewed the issue on April 24 and decided to conduct a recall covering 3,791 5th- and 6th-generation ADS vehicles (production dates March 17, 2022 to April 20, 2026). Waymo is developing the final remedy. NHTSA Part 573 recall report 26E026.","occurredAt":"2026-04-20T00:00:00.000Z","reviewStatus":"reviewed","modelId":null,"deploymentId":null,"companyId":"2128addc-20c8-4c31-aef5-be5ada97aede","aliases":[],"collisionRisk":"none","reviewNote":null,"severity":"moderate","rootCauseCategory":null,"rootCauseDetail":null,"affectedUnitsCount":3791,"affectedUnitsBasis":"exact","remediationStatus":"in_progress","regulatoryAction":"recall_ordered","regulatoryBody":"NHTSA","propertyDamageEstimateUsd":null,"damageEstimateBasis":null,"bodilyInjurySeverity":null,"fatalityCount":null,"lossCostClass":null,"sourceQualityTier":null,"oshaRecordable":null,"oshaCaseNumber":null,"rootCauseDisclosed":null,"publicDisclosureDate":null,"insuranceClaimPublic":null,"formFactor":null,"latitude":null,"longitude":null,"autonomyClass":null,"legalOutcomeClass":"unknown","createdAt":"2026-07-25T07:46:49.949Z","updatedAt":"2026-08-09T05:24:01.599Z","model":null,"deployment":null,"company":{"id":"2128addc-20c8-4c31-aef5-be5ada97aede","name":"Waymo","slug":"waymo","description":"Waymo is Alphabet's autonomous driving subsidiary.
